A new museum in Doha is all set to be the largest institution dedicated to the artist, tracing his journey from the 1950s

- Avantika Bhuyan

n 2008, while living in Doha, M.F. Husain completed a sketch of a building, resplendent in blue, with waters of the Persian Gulf visible in the background. This was his blueprint for the M.F. Husain Art & Cinema Museum-a vision which is finally coming to fruition in a country that offered him citizenship and a home during the artist's self-imposed exile from India.

Titled the Lawh Wa Qalam: M.F. Husain Museum, the 3,000 sq. m space will open on 28 November within Qatar Foundation's Education City. Hailed as the "world's first and largest institution dedicated to tracing Husain's artistic journey from the 1950s until his death", the design of the museum has been completed by Delhi-based architect Martand Khosla. He calls this an incredible opportunity, which allows him to be in conversation with the artist via the drawing that he left behind for his own museum.
